About This Center
Darling Ingredients is a company focused on moving towards a more circular economy by repurposing millions of tons of material from the animal agriculture and food industries to nourish people, feed animals and crops, and fuel the world with renewable energy. They offer solutions in three main operating segments: Feed, Food, and Fuel, providing essential ingredients for animal nutrition, fertilizers, renewable fuels, and food ingredients to enhance human health. Darling Ingredients also converts wastewater emissions into renewable natural gas (RNG) at their Dublin, Georgia facility, reducing Scope 1 emissions. They have a global impact, transforming animal by-products into valuable new products at their 260 facilities worldwide, producing billions of gallons of renewable fuel and returning billions of gallons of water back to the environment annually. Additionally, they have launched Nextida GC, a new collagen peptide, and have partnered with Avfuel Corporation to produce sustainable aviation fuel.
